Patent Searching and Data


Title:
ELECTRIC CLEANER
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PH0646971
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

PURPOSE: To prevent invasion of cold air from outside when harmful worms in a dust collecting chamber are driven away by circulating hot air within a cleaner body.

CONSTITUTION: A sealing plate 11 is mounted on a suction mouth 5 to clog an end on the rearside of a terminal insertion hole 5c and another end on the rearside of a hook escape hole 5b of the suction mouth 5. When cleaning is finished by an electric cleaner M, a joint 7 is dismounted from the suction mouth 5 and a shutter 6 is closed. Next, an electromotive fan is driven to circulate air in a cleaner body through a fan housing chamber, an air passage, the suction mouth 5 and a dust collecting chamber in this order. Then by heat of the electromotive fan, the air in the cleaner body is heated little by little. The air in the dust collecting chamber finally rises up to a prescribed temperature, whereby harmful worms such as ticks die.
